Preparation ❷ Identification document check

Identification documents must be presented at the runner registration desk.
Please check the list below and remember to bring this!

Documents requiring only one form for confirmation:
  • Passport
  • Resident Card
  • Personal Number Card (My Number Card)
  • Driver's License
  • Driving Record Certificate
  • Special Permanent Resident Certificate
  • Physical Disability Certificate
  • Mental Disability Certificate
  • Rehabilitation Certificate

or

Documents requiring two forms (A + B) for confirmation:
A(With photo)
  • Certificate issued by a corporation (employee ID card, etc.)
  • student ID card
  • credit card
  • Taspo
B(Documents issued by public institutions)
  • My Number Card as your Health Insurance Certificate
  • nursing care insurance card
  • national pension book
  • certificate of residence
  • * The Basic Resident Register Card and health insurance card cannot be used as they have expired.

Venue guide

Date and Time

February 20, 2026 (Fri) 11:00-19:00 (Exhibition area will be opened until 19:30)

February 21, 2026 (Sat) 10:00-18:00 (Exhibition area will be opened until 18:30)

  • * There will be no check-in on February 22(Sun), the day of the race.
  • * Check-in after the above operation hours is not accepted, even if there is a delay in public transportation, so please come with plenty of time.

Venue

INTEX Osaka, Hall 3

Address 1-5-102 NANKO-Kita, Suminoe-KU, Osaka City
Access about 5minutes walk from "Nakafuto Station" on Osaka Metro New Tram,
about 8minutes walk from "Trade Center-mae Station" on Osaka Metro New Tram,
about 9minutes walk from "Cosmo square station" on Osaka Metro Chuo Line.

Registration flow

1Identification Counter

●ID Check(personal identification)

Go to the personal identification counter and present your smartphone screen or a pre-printed athlete bib exchange voucher and identification document.

●Pick up and "Meeting place map & running course map"

2Athlete Bib exchange Counter

●Wearing security band

All runners are required to wear them

●Athlete bib exchange

Please pick up your athlete bib, etc.

Only for Applicant

3Charity goods Pick up counter

●Charity Goods Pick up

Please pick up charity goods only if you have applied for them at the time of entry.

Only for those who wish

4Cloak counter

●Checking in your suitcase

You can check-in your suitcases at the cloakroom. You can enjoy the EXPO venue with less luggage.

* 600 yen per suitcase. Payment is cashless only.

Only for eligible people

5General Information(in Hall2)

●"Heart Supporter Badge" Picik Up

If you have taken a class of first aid, you will receive a "Heart Supporter Badge" in exchange for showing your certificate of attendance. Please wear the badge on your left chest on the race day.

Attachment of Security Band

  • The color changes depending on the type of runner.
  • Please understand that as part of our security measures, you will be asked to wear the wristwatch when you register and to wear it until the race day.
◎Notes
  • *There will be no check-in on February 22(Sun), the day of the race.
  • *Check-in after the above operation hours is not accepted, even if there is a delay in public transportation, so please come with plenty of time.
  • *Receipts for participation fees will not be issued at the reception desk. Please use the statement or invoice issued by your credit card company as your receipt.
  • *Participants with disabilities who will run with a guide runner must bring either a Physical Disability Certificate, a Mental Disability Health and Welfare Certificate, or a Rehabilitation Certificate and register in the same process as general runners. However, guide runners must complete identity verification and registration at the Help Desk (refer to P3).
